Keep using your old batteries

Rewired your AEG to Deans but still have a drawer full of Tamiya batteries? This adapter is the answer. Female Deans on one end, male mini Tamiya on the other, so a Deans-wired gun or charger can run your existing Tamiya packs with no waste.

No workshop needed

Converting every battery to Deans means a lot of soldering. This adapter avoids all of it. Plug it into the gun’s Deans lead, connect your Tamiya battery, and you are back in the fight in seconds.

Easy to route

The lead is flexible silicone-insulated wire, typically 14 to 18 AWG, so it bends neatly into crane stocks, buffer tubes and handguards instead of springing back and fouling the gearbox.

Mind the polarity

Some airsoft Tamiya wiring is reverse polarity to the RC norm, so always check red to red and black to black through the whole chain before firing. Find more batteries and connectors in our BBs, gas and batteries section.

Charger friendly too

It also works on charger output leads, so a Deans charger can top up Tamiya batteries without buying a second unit.

Frequently asked questions

What does this adapter do?

It lets a gun or charger wired with a male Deans / T-plug accept a battery that still has a mini Tamiya connector. Plug the adapter into your Deans lead, then plug the Tamiya battery in.

When would I need it?

Most commonly after you rewire an AEG to Deans but still own Tamiya batteries you do not want to throw away. The adapter lets you keep using them without rewiring every battery.

Does it hurt performance?

Any extra connector adds slight resistance, so on extreme builds a full rewire is ideal. For typical skirmish AEGs the impact is minimal and the convenience is worth it.

Do I need to check polarity?

Yes. Airsoft Tamiya wiring can be reverse polarity versus the RC standard, so always confirm red to red and black to black through the whole chain before firing to avoid a short.
